/*! elementor-pro - v3.18.0 - 17-01-2024 */ "use strict"; (self["webpackChunkelementor_pro"] = self["webpackChunkelementor_pro"] || []).push([["slides"],{ /***/ "../modules/slides/assets/js/frontend/handlers/slides.js": /*!***************************************************************!*\ !*** ../modules/slides/assets/js/frontend/handlers/slides.js ***! \***************************************************************/ /***/ ((__unused_webpack_module, exports) => { Object.defineProperty(exports, "__esModule", ({ value: true })); exports["default"] = void 0; class SlidesHandler extends elementorModules.frontend.handlers.SwiperBase { getDefaultSettings() { return { selectors: { slider: '.elementor-slides-wrapper', slide: '.swiper-slide', slideInnerContents: '.swiper-slide-contents', activeSlide: '.swiper-slide-active', activeDuplicate: '.swiper-slide-duplicate-active' }, classes: { animated: 'animated', kenBurnsActive: 'elementor-ken-burns--active', slideBackground: 'swiper-slide-bg' }, attributes: { dataSliderOptions: 'slider_options', dataAnimation: 'animation' } }; } getDefaultElements() { const selectors = this.getSettings('selectors'), elements = { $swiperContainer: this.$element.find(selectors.slider) }; elements.$slides = elements.$swiperContainer.find(selectors.slide); return elements; } getSwiperOptions() { const elementSettings = this.getElementSettings(), swiperOptions = { autoplay: this.getAutoplayConfig(), grabCursor: true, initialSlide: this.getInitialSlide(), slidesPerView: 1, slidesPerGroup: 1, loop: 'yes' === elementSettings.infinite, speed: elementSettings.transition_speed, effect: elementSettings.transition, observeParents: true, observer: true, handleElementorBreakpoints: true, on: { slideChange: () => { this.handleKenBurns(); } } }; const showArrows = 'arrows' === elementSettings.navigation || 'both' === elementSettings.navigation, pagination = 'dots' === elementSettings.navigation || 'both' === elementSettings.navigation; if (showArrows) { swiperOptions.navigation = { prevEl: '.elementor-swiper-button-prev', nextEl: '.elementor-swiper-button-next' }; } if (pagination) { swiperOptions.pagination = { el: '.swiper-pagination', type: 'bullets', clickable: true }; } if (true === swiperOptions.loop) { swiperOptions.loopedSlides = this.getSlidesCount(); } if ('fade' === swiperOptions.effect) { swiperOptions.fadeEffect = { crossFade: true }; } return swiperOptions; } getAutoplayConfig() { const elementSettings = this.getElementSettings(); if ('yes' !== elementSettings.autoplay) { return false; } return { stopOnLastSlide: true, // Has no effect in infinite mode by default. delay: elementSettings.autoplay_speed, disableOnInteraction: 'yes' === elementSettings.pause_on_interaction }; } initSingleSlideAnimations() { const settings = this.getSettings(), animation = this.elements.$swiperContainer.data(settings.attributes.dataAnimation); this.elements.$swiperContainer.find('.' + settings.classes.slideBackground).addClass(settings.classes.kenBurnsActive); // If there is an animation, get the container of the slide's inner contents and add the animation classes to it if (animation) { this.elements.$swiperContainer.find(settings.selectors.slideInnerContents).addClass(settings.classes.animated + ' ' + animation); } } async initSlider() { const $slider = this.elements.$swiperContainer; if (!$slider.length) { return; } if (1 >= this.getSlidesCount()) { return; } const Swiper = elementorFrontend.utils.swiper; this.swiper = await new Swiper($slider, this.getSwiperOptions()); // Expose the swiper instance in the frontend $slider.data('swiper', this.swiper); // The Ken Burns effect will only apply on the specific slides that toggled the effect ON, // since it depends on an additional class besides 'elementor-ken-burns--active' this.handleKenBurns(); const elementSettings = this.getElementSettings(); if (elementSettings.pause_on_hover) { this.togglePauseOnHover(true); } const settings = this.getSettings(); const animation = $slider.data(settings.attributes.dataAnimation); if (!animation) { return; } this.swiper.on('slideChangeTransitionStart', function () { const $sliderContent = $slider.find(settings.selectors.slideInnerContents); $sliderContent.removeClass(settings.classes.animated + ' ' + animation).hide(); }); this.swiper.on('slideChangeTransitionEnd', function () { const $currentSlide = $slider.find(settings.selectors.slideInnerContents); $currentSlide.show().addClass(settings.classes.animated + ' ' + animation); }); } onInit() { elementorModules.frontend.handlers.Base.prototype.onInit.apply(this, arguments); if (2 > this.getSlidesCount()) { this.initSingleSlideAnimations(); return; } this.initSlider(); } getChangeableProperties() { return { pause_on_hover: 'pauseOnHover', pause_on_interaction: 'disableOnInteraction', autoplay_speed: 'delay', transition_speed: 'speed' }; } updateSwiperOption(propertyName) { if (0 === propertyName.indexOf('width')) { this.swiper.update(); return; } const elementSettings = this.getElementSettings(), newSettingValue = elementSettings[propertyName], changeableProperties = this.getChangeableProperties(); let propertyToUpdate = changeableProperties[propertyName], valueToUpdate = newSettingValue; // Handle special cases where the value to update is not the value that the Swiper library accepts switch (propertyName) { case 'autoplay_speed': propertyToUpdate = 'autoplay'; valueToUpdate = { delay: newSettingValue, disableOnInteraction: 'yes' === elementSettings.pause_on_interaction }; break; case 'pause_on_hover': this.togglePauseOnHover('yes' === newSettingValue); break; case 'pause_on_interaction': valueToUpdate = 'yes' === newSettingValue; break; } // 'pause_on_hover' is implemented by the handler with event listeners, not the Swiper library if ('pause_on_hover' !== propertyName) { this.swiper.params[propertyToUpdate] = valueToUpdate; } this.swiper.update(); } onElementChange(propertyName) { if (1 >= this.getSlidesCount()) { return; } const changeableProperties = this.getChangeableProperties(); if (Object.prototype.hasOwnProperty.call(changeableProperties, propertyName)) { this.updateSwiperOption(propertyName); this.swiper.autoplay.start(); } } onEditSettingsChange(propertyName) { if (1 >= this.getSlidesCount()) { return; } if ('activeItemIndex' === propertyName) { this.swiper.slideToLoop(this.getEditSettings('activeItemIndex') - 1); this.swiper.autoplay.stop(); } } } exports["default"] = SlidesHandler; /***/ }) }]); //# sourceMappingURL=slides.3b185c687f9167dfae0c.bundle.js.map Best No deposit Bonuses in america for 2025 - Xalleria
Search

You have no bookmark.

Best No deposit Bonuses in america for 2025

Insane Local casino are market commander in the holding mobile-founded position online game. Here, you might talk about more eight hundred position headings from celebrated games builders. You may also take part in a regular $5,100 cash ports contest. The new slot online game’s incentive video game features tend to be Free Revolves, Play Ability, Wilds, and you will Growing Signs.

William Mountain Bingo

After you decide-in the through the an active period and put $20, you’ll score an excellent $10 account borrowing you could use position video game. The advantage to have West Virginia people now offers a first-deposit suits as high as $2,500, and a good $50 gambling establishment incentive, and you may 50 added bonus revolves. Borgata Gambling enterprise is offering the new people a premier roller incentive out of to $1,000. That it incentive try a first put suits, which means you’ll need create a player membership, use the added bonus password ODDSBONUS, and make a great being qualified deposit so you can allege they.

More like 100 percent free Spins Bonuses

  • Because the latter are fully fulfilled, the worth of the advantage try rewarded to the user.
  • But not, so it doesn’t signify you could potentially’t claim the specified amount.
  • After you allege a no-deposit added bonus, your generally discover bonus currency without the need to gamble.
  • But not, don’t forget to read the principles prior to using this bonus, such rollover conditions.

We’re constantly focusing on finding the current no- https://real-money-pokies.net/wild-vegas-casino/ deposit bonuses and choosing a knowledgeable web based casinos. While the the new no deposit sites will always on the all of our radar, you can be assured that offers and you can gambling enterprises searched about page are relevant and you can the best inside Canada. Deposit a flat matter while the shown by gambling enterprise and you can gamble so it thanks to in your favourite on the internet position game, usually to the weekdays. After you get to the wagering demands, you could potentially allege their additional revolves.

Have a tendency to, these send-in the bonuses are to own a nice amount of totally free coins, such 5 South carolina. But not, here is the providers are extremely sort of. The greater amount of your deposit, the greater added bonus currency you get. Comprehend the Stake.us Local casino sweepstakes remark to learn more, and rehearse all of our personal Stake.you bonus password ‘COVERSBONUS’ when joining. Fool around with ‘COVERSBONUS’ the fresh exclusive Wow Las vegas promo password to get started. Inspire Vegas’ no-deposit incentive boasts 250,one hundred thousand Impress Gold coins and you may 5 Sweepstakes Gold coins spread across your first 3 days once membership.

casino games gta online

This really is to advertise particular online game or even to play with popular video game in order to draw in the brand new players on the webpages. Although not, when you’ve put your spins immediately after, you should be able to use the left incentive harmony in order to most other video game to possess wagering. You should be aware specific online game including dining table games and you may progressive jackpots wear’t constantly sign up for wagering conditions. TalkSPORT Choice Casino’s 100 percent free revolves promotions are often tied to particular position game; this provides participants the ability to have the best games first hand. Totally free spins incentives aren’t really the only bonuses to be had right here; there are plenty of other bonuses for both the brand new and you can returning players, putting some website satisfying to possess dedicated players. Sky Vegas has some of the most extremely forgiving fine print out there, especially for zero-deposit totally free spins!

  • That it day, Lemon Gambling establishment shines with a deal from 20 100 percent free spins to your Larger Trout Bonanza for brand new profiles.
  • There are a few offers during the FanDuel also, including the FanDuel Prize Host you could spin daily to own a chance in the many.
  • All give a way to play for a real income rather than placing your own.
  • For each and every gambling establishment offer have an optimum extra number, assisting you align your standards and methods.
  • The new people score a flavor of added bonus majesty having Jackpota’s homerun no-put worth 7,five-hundred coins with 2.5 sweepstakes gold coins.

They’ll and continually be attached to most other incentives, including in initial deposit-match bonus. Successful is never guaranteed, however, no-put bonuses assist edge chances nearer to their like. You’re reducing the danger but using bonus financing as opposed to the individual bucks. That have list earnings each year, it’s not surprising that marketplace is becoming more cutthroat. Finest incentives such as worthwhile no-deposit incentives let draw in the newest professionals to the casinos.

Heavens try a well-understood brand in britain, that is thought about by many because the a mainstay from United kingdom sports and you can playing, however, did you realize what’s more, it have a great gambling enterprise website? Air Las vegas machines hundreds of sophisticated game, popular with all types of participants. Near the top of your antique harbors, you’ll discover your entire favourite table game, for example roulette and black-jack, in addition to alive differences. Wild Western Victories also provides 20 totally free spins on the Cowboys Silver for the fresh people. The new revolves include a steep 65x betting requirements and you will a great limitation cash-out of £fifty.

vegas x no deposit bonus

Make sure to test the minimum put restrict otherwise activation code to help you allege which extra properly. The brand new adrenaline hurry you earn when to experience ports for real bucks is actually unmatchable. Even though your 100 percent free revolves wear’t want any wagering, you can be minimal in the way much you could withdraw out of your extra. Not all bonuses will get limitation earn limits, but 100 percent free revolves be most likely than nearly any most other bonus in order to element them. Often, the newest win cap try proportional to the value of the bonus and how much every person twist is definitely worth.

Societal gambling enterprises always never ever need you to spend money to play game. Realize all of our casino professional suggestions to take advantage out of your own stated free spins. Once you intend to claim no-deposit 100 percent free revolves, you’ll find several things you can do to maximise your own gains. By the applying such actions, you could potentially improve your chances of turning totally free revolves on the real money.

  • June 11, 2025
  • Uncategorized
  • Comments Off on Best No deposit Bonuses in america for 2025

Reset Your Password